Weak Airflow or Warm Air
If you feel warm air coming from your vents when the thermostat is set to “cool,” or if the airflow feels noticeably weaker than usual, your compressor may be failing. It could also point to a blockage in your ductwork or a refrigerant leak. Since these components are vital to the cooling process, continued operation can cause irreparable damage to the entire unit.

Unusual Noises and Odors
Modern AC units should operate relatively quietly. Squealing, grinding, or banging sounds often mean a belt is out of place or a motor bearing is failing. Similarly, a pungent or musty smell can indicate burned-out wire insulation or mold growth inside the unit. If you detect either, shut the system down and call a licensed technician immediately to avoid fire hazards or indoor air quality issues.
Frequent cycling is another common sign of trouble. While it’s normal for your AC to turn on more often on a hot day, it shouldn’t constantly cycle on and off every few minutes. This puts massive strain on the electrical components and will eventually burn out the motor.
